AGARTALA, Sep 18 (TIWN): As only 3 days left for by-election campaigning in Tripura's Badharghat-14 constituency, political parties are busy in party-propaganda and massive election campaigning on Wednesday. 21st September is the last date for the campaigning and 23rd September is the Election date. Opposition parties said, if rigging and illegal tricks are not used then BJP's defeat is must, whereas BJP said there is nothing to worry about BJP's victory as the party will win 100% with massive voting percentage.
By-election to be held on September 23rd in the Badharghat-14 constituency. The seat left vacated after BJP MLA Dilip Sarkar passed away.
Congress candidate for the election is Ratan Das, CPI-M Bulti Biswas and BJP has selected Mimi Chakraborty.
